Good Hope School

Good Hope School (GHS; Traditional Chinese: 德望學校) is a girls' school in Hong Kong with primary and secondary sections, founded in 1954. It is conducted by Missionary Sisters of the Immaculate Conception (M.I.C.). It is located at the junction of Ngau Chi Wan Street and Clear Water Bay Road, on the hill in the eastern outskirt of Ngau Chi Wan. It is a band one school and is known for its academic, athletics and musical achievements.
